5 Effective Ways to transfer files between iphone and mac:
1. Syncing
If your Mac is running the most recent version of macOS Catalina, you can simply transfer files between the Mac and iPhone via a USB cable or by syncing over the same Wi-Fi network.
Follow the steps given below to transfer files from an iPhone and a Mac using an USB cable:
- Connect the devices together with an USB cable.
- Select your iDevice in “Finder” by going there.
- Select the categories of media you wish to transfer, such as music, movies, files, and more, and you will be provided with a list of applications.
- Drag a file or files from a Finder window into the app to start transferring files from Mac to iPhone.
Follow the steps given below to transfer files between an iPhone and a Mac using wi-fi connection:
- Use an USB cable to connect the iPhone to the Mac. Navigate to Finder and choose your iDevice from the sidebar. Navigate to the “General” page and enable the option “Show this [device] when on Wi-Fi.”
- According to your requirements, adjust the syncing options and hit “Apply.”
- You can choose the iPhone in the sidebar and sync it when your Mac and iPhone are synced through Wi-Fi.

2. Itunes
File-sharing apps let you transfer files between your Mac and your iPhone. Visit the documentation for the app in question to see if it supports this connectivity. Follow the steps given below to transfer files between Iphone and mac using Itunes:
- Connect your Mac and iPhone.
- Select the “Device” button above the sidebar of the iTunes window in the Mac’s iTunes software.
- Click “File Sharing.”
- From the list on the left, choose the app you wish to send a file to.
- Start the iPhone and Mac file transfer process.
- To transfer files from your Mac to your iPhone, click “Add,” then choose the file you wish to transfer.
- Files can be transferred from an iPhone to a Mac by selecting the file in the list on the right, clicking “Save to” and then choosing the destination folder. Then select “Save To” one more.
When it’s finished, you may check the transferred files in the location or app.
3. Airdrop
On Macs and iOS devices, the built-in file-sharing application is called AirDrop. You can transfer files through Bluetooth and Wi-Fi while AirDrop is on between two iOS devices or between an iOS device and a Mac. To transfer files between an iPhone and a Mac using AirDrop, follow these steps:
- On your iOS device, open “Control Center.” Make sure both “Bluetooth” and “Wi-Fi” are turned on, then select “AirDrop” and choose whether your iPhone should be detected by “Contacts Only” or “Everyone.”
- To enable AirDrop on your Mac, go to “Finder” > “Go” > “AirDrop” and enable “Bluetooth” and “WiFi.” Set the “Allow to be discovered by” option to “Everyone” or “Contacts Only.”
- You are now free to easily share files between your Mac and your iPhone or iPad with AirDrop. AirDrop allows you to transfer files from your Mac to your iPhone in two ways
- Drag the images you wish to transmit from Mac to iPhone to the image of the recipient and then click “Send.”
- Otherwise, you may use an app’s “Share” button to select “AirDrop,” then select the receiver and click “Done.”
4. icloud
Users may store files in iCloud and access them from iCloud.com, Macs, PCs, and iOS devices using iCloud Drive. You have control over which files and folders are saved in iCloud Drive.
You may access these files on all of your devices that share the same Apple ID if iCloud Drive is enabled. Follow the steps given below to share files between iphone and mac:
Transfer from an iPhone to a Mac | Transfer from a Mac to iPhone |
---|---|
1. First, open the file you want to transfer, then press the share icon, which is a square with an upward-pointing arrow. | 1. Copy the file you want to transfer and put it in the Finder’s iCloud Drive folder. |
2. Select Save to Files by swiping down. | 2. Select iCloud Drive from the list of accessible locations in the Files app on your iPhone. |
3. Choose iCloud Drive from the new menu that displays. | 3. Tap on the 3 dots in the upper right corner of the screen and then on Select. |
4. Hit Save. | 4. Select the file you want to send by tapping it. |
5. Open Finder on your Mac and select iCloud Drive. You can find your file there. | 5. Select how you want to send the file by tapping the Share button. This might be done by choosing Save Image if the file is a picture or another choice if the file is another kind of file. |
5. Email
On your computer, make a new email, add the files you want to transfer as attachments, and then compose the email to your own account. After that, check your iPhone’s inbox and download the files to your iOS device. Similar to this, you can transfer files from an iPhone to a Mac by creating an email and sending it using the Email app.
Depending on the size of the files and the speed of the network connection, methods like AirDrop or email could take you sometime to transfer files. If you only have a few files to transfer that are only a little size, you are advised to try these options.
